Course Outline

Introduction to Agentic AI

  • Defining agentic AI and its distinction from traditional AI systems
  • An overview of reasoning, memory, and goal-oriented architectures
  • Highlighting key use cases and industry applications

Key Concepts and Architectural Patterns

  • The agent loop: understanding perception, reasoning, and action
  • Comparing single-agent and multi-agent systems
  • Interacting with environments and invoking tools

Basics of Prompt Engineering

  • Crafting effective prompts for reasoning and breaking down complex tasks
  • Leveraging examples, constraints, and role assignments for precise control
  • Systematically debugging and refining prompts

Creating Simple Agentic Workflows

  • Building an agent loop using Python
  • Connecting to APIs and basic tools
  • Handling agent state and memory management

Responsible Design and Safety Protocols

  • Exploring ethical considerations and the responsible use of agents
  • Addressing bias, transparency, and accountability in AI systems
  • Implementing access control, data privacy, and content safety measures

Practical Project: Designing a Responsible Agent

  • Establishing problem scope and project objectives
  • Formulating prompts and control logic
  • Testing, iterating, and assessing agent performance

Requirements

  • A foundational grasp of AI or machine learning concepts
  • Proficiency in Python syntax and scripting
  • Practical experience with data handling or API-driven applications

Target Audience

  • Data scientists new to developing agentic AI
  • Junior ML engineers investigating applied agent architectures
  • Technology leaders aiming to comprehend agent design and safety protocols
